Tissue Regenix wins award at US conference

The medical devices maker won the Supplier Horizon award at a conference hosted by group purchasing organisation Premier

Medical devices maker Tissue Regenix Group PLC (LON:TRX) has won an award at an industry conference over in the United States.

Group purchasing organisation Premier awarded Tissue the Supplier Horizon award, which recognises suppliers that have been contracted with Premier for less than three years for exceptional local customer service and engagement, value creation through clinical excellence and commitment to lower costs.

The awards are voted on by Premier’s members who have first-hand experience of using the products in a clinical setting.

It’s not the first time TRX has been recognised by Premier back in 2016 its dermal allograft, DermaPure, was presented with an Innovative Technology award.

“We are delighted to receive the Premier Horizon award,” said chief executive Steve Couldwell.

“It again highlights not only the differentiated clinical outcomes from the use of DermaPure, but also the health economic advantages of its' single application in many hospital settings.

“Being acknowledged by Premier's member institutions for such an award re affirms our value proposition in the space, and we look forward to continuing to establish these relationships.”
